Explore the Charm of Peerumedu: A Historic Hill Station Near Elamvilla

For guests at Elamvilla, a visit to Peerumedu is a journey into the heart of Kerala’s highlands. Located just a short drive away, Peerumedu is a quaint hill station renowned for its lush greenery, sprawling plantations, and historical significance. Once the summer retreat of the Travancore royal family, Peerumedu now offers a serene escape for travelers who want to explore the rich cultural and natural heritage of Kerala.

Perched at an altitude of about 915 meters above sea level, Peerumedu is surrounded by rolling hills covered with tea, coffee, and spice plantations. The cool, misty climate, combined with the breathtaking landscapes, makes it an ideal destination for those looking to experience the quieter, less commercial side of Kerala’s hill stations.

Things to Do in Peerumedu

  • Visit Plantation Estates: Peerumedu is known for its tea, coffee, and spice plantations. Take a guided tour of one of these estates to learn more about the cultivation process, sample fresh produce, and enjoy the scenic views of the plantations.
  • Explore Royal History: Peerumedu has a rich history as the summer residence of the royal family of Travancore. You can visit Summer Palace and the Royal Tombs, which provide a glimpse into the regal past of the area.
  • Trekking and Nature Walks: The undulating hills of Peerumedu are perfect for trekking. There are several trails for both beginners and seasoned hikers, offering stunning views of the surrounding valleys and mountains. The trails pass through forests, waterfalls, and spice plantations, allowing visitors to experience the region’s biodiversity.
  • Peeru Hills: Named after Peer Mohammed, a Sufi saint, Peeru Hills is a spiritual and scenic spot near Peerumedu. It’s a tranquil place ideal for meditation, nature walks, and picnics with panoramic views of the valley.

Best Time to Visit
The best time to visit Peerumedu is during the cooler months, from October to February, when the weather is perfect for exploring the outdoors. However, the monsoon season (June to September) also brings its own charm, with lush greenery and mist enveloping the hills, making the landscape even more enchanting.
